Usual Adult Dose for COVID-19
For investigational use only
Primary series: 0.5 mL IM for 2 doses, administered 1 month apart
-Third primary series dose (if indicated): 0.5 mL IM administered at least 1 month after the second dose
Booster Dose: 0.25 mL IM, at least 5 months after completing a primary series of COVID-19 vaccination.
Comments:
-The US FDA issued an Emergency Use Authorization (EUA) to allow the emergency use of this unapproved product for active immunization to prevent co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19). This product is not approved by the US FDA for this use.
-There are no data available regarding interchangeability of COVID-19 vaccine products; the same vaccine product should be used for both doses.
-A third primary series dose is authorized for patients who have undergone solid organ transplantation, or who are diagnosed with conditions that are considered to have an equivalent level of immunocompromise.
-For additional information: https://www.fda.gov/emergency-preparedness-and-response/mcm-legal-regulatory-and-policy-framework/emergency-use-authorization
Use: Active immunization against COVID-19 due to SARS-CoV-2

Precautions
CONTRAINDICATIONS:
-Known history of severe allergic reactions (e.g., anaphylaxis) to the active component or any of the ingredients
Safety and efficacy have not been established in patients younger than 18 years.

Other Comments
Administration advice:
-Administer IM.
-Gently swirl the vial between doses; do not shake.
Storage requirements:
-Store frozen between -50C to -58C (-13F to 5F); store in original package to protect from light.
-Do not store on dry ice or below -50C (-58F).
-Thaw each vial before use; once thawed, do not return vial to freezer.
-Thawed vials may be handled in room light conditions.
-Vials may be stored between 8C and 25C (46F to 77F) for a total of 24 hours.
---Thaw in refrigerator between 2C to 8C (36F to 46F) for 2.5 hours for the maximum 11-dose vial (3 hours for maximum 15-dose vial) and let vial stand at room temperature for 15 minutes before administration; discard after 12 hours.
---Alternatively, thaw at room temperature between 15C to 25C (59F to 77F) for 1 hour for the maximum 11-dose vial (90 minutes for maximum 15-dose vial); total storage time should not exceed 12 hours.
-May store vials in refrigerator between 2C to 8C (36F to 46F) for up to 30 days prior to first use.
-In use vial (needle-punctured): Store between 2C to 25C (36F to 77F); discard vial 12 hours after first puncture.
-Do not refreeze.
Reconstitution/preparation techniques:
-Do not dilute.
-Consult the Fact Sheet for Health Care Providers.
General:
-This vaccine may contain white or translucent particulates.
-Vaccination providers enrolled in the federal COVID-19 Vaccination Program must report all vaccine administration errors, all serious adverse events, cases of Multisystem Inflammatory Syndrome (MIS) in adults, and cases of COVID-19 that result in hospitalization or death following administration of this vaccine.
